VP Balloting - DNC 1848 |
Contender: Ballot | 1st | 2d before shifts | 2d after shifts |
William O. Butler KY | 114 | 169 | 290 |
John A. Quitman MS | 74 | 62 | 0 |
Abstaining | 38 | 37 | 0 |
William R.D. King AL | 26 | 8 | 0 |
John Y. Mason VA | 24 | 3 | 0 |
James I. McKay NC | 13 | 11 | 0 |
Jefferson Davis MS | 1 | 0 | 0 |
